Why These Are the Top Toyota Repair Auto Repair Shops in South Haven

** The Toyota repair market for South Haven residents is characterized by a reliance on service providers in larger neighboring cities. South Haven itself lacks a dedicated Toyota dealership or a high-volume, Toyota-specific independent shop. The closest and most comprehensive option is the Lakeside Toyota dealership in Benton Harbor (~20-minute drive), which sets the benchmark for certified service and hybrid system expertise but at a premium cost. The competitive landscape is filled with general auto repair shops within South Haven, but for the specialized services requested (especially hybrid and complex transmission work), residents typically travel to Benton Harbor or Holland. Independent shops like Muffler Man and DeHaan Automotive offer a high-quality, often more personalized and cost-effective alternative to the dealership for standard engine, transmission, and electrical work. Pricing in the region is competitive, with dealership labor rates being the highest, and reputable independents offering rates 15-25% lower while still providing expert service for Toyota models.

What are the most common Toyota repair issues you see in South Haven due to our local climate and driving conditions?

The most frequent issues for Toyotas in South Haven involve corrosion from winter road salt on brake lines and exhaust components, as well as premature wear on suspension parts from our seasonal potholes. We also see increased demand for battery testing and replacement due to the strain of cold Michigan winters on starting systems.

When should I seek local service for my Toyota's check engine light instead of trying to diagnose it myself?

You should seek professional service immediately if the light is flashing, indicating a severe misfire, or if you notice any performance issues like loss of power or rough idling. For a steady light, a South Haven shop can provide a precise diagnosis, which is crucial as the light could relate to anything from a loose gas cap to local ethanol-blended fuel issues or more serious emissions system faults.

What local considerations should I keep in mind for Toyota maintenance in South Haven?

Given our proximity to Lake Michigan and seasonal road treatments, undercarriage washes in winter are critical to fight rust. Furthermore, preparing your Toyota's cooling system for summer and checking tire pressure with temperature swings are vital. Scheduling seasonal check-ups in spring and fall at a local shop can help address wear from our variable coastal climate.
